The german sign language family is a small language family of sign languages, including german sign language, polish sign language and probably israeli sign language. German sign language or deutsche gebardensprache dgs, is the sign language of the deaf community in germany and in the german speaking community of belgium. Wermkes and her colleagues made headlines with a study showing that french and german newborns produce distinctly different cry melodies, reflecting the languages they heard in utero. Baby sign language is the use of manual signing allowing infants and toddlers to communicate emotions, desires, and objects prior to spoken language development.
